Four, including three juveniles, arrested for rape and murder of minor girl in Delhi’s Swaroop Nagar

Four individuals, including three juveniles, were arrested on Thursday (September 17, 2026) in connection with the rape and murder of a minor girl whose body was found in an open field in Swaroop Nagar, north Delhi, on September 13.

The accused were apprehended within 72 hours of the discovery of the body. One of the accused has been identified as Shivam (19) alias Sudama alias Chuchu, a resident of Khadda Colony in Swaroop Nagar.

Sources in the Outer North police said the accused and the victim were known to each other and were neighbourhood friends.

“The prime accused, Shivam, and the victim girl were in a relationship, and all five of them were neighbourhood friends. They had all met, following which an argument erupted among the group. The accused then sexually assaulted and killed the girl,” said Outer North DCP Shobhit D. Saxena.

Police are also investigating whether the accused were under the influence of alcohol or any other intoxicating substance at the time of the incident.

The body was found on the morning of September 13 in an open field near Jaipal Rana’s field along Lal Boundary, Kushak Road, following which a team from the Swaroop Nagar police station reached the spot. The deceased was initially unidentified.

The body was sent for preservation and postmortem examination.

Based on the circumstances and material collected during the preliminary investigation, police registered a case under the Section 6 of the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Act and relevant sections of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ita at Swaroop Nagar police station.

More than 50 CCTV cameras were scrutinised during which the investigators noticed a suspected tempo moving in the vicinity around the relevant time. Its registration number, however, could not initially be read clearly because of poor visibility and darkness.

The team then tracked the movement of vehicles across multiple CCTV cameras and correlated the footage with field verification to establish the identity and route of the suspected vehicle, according to the police.

Based on the leads developed during the investigation, a night-long search operation was conducted during the intervening night of September 15 and 16. The suspected tempo was eventually traced parked in Khadda Colony, Swaroop Nagar.

Police identified and questioned its driver, following which further investigation led to the apprehension of the four persons.

Two knives used in the crime, clothes worn by the accused at the time of the incident and the suspected tempo have been recovered.

Further investigation is underway to establish the sequence of events and ascertain the individual role of each of the four apprehended persons.
